One of the strengths of VATSIM Germany is its community-driven approach. The Knowledgebase is maintained by real-world pilots, ATCs, and software engineers. If you spot an error or a missing procedure, you don't just complain on Discord.

The KB has a "Suggest an Edit" button. Submitting a suggestion requires providing evidence (a real-world chart or a VATSIM policy document). This crowdsourcing ensures the knowledgebase remains the most accurate simulation documentation in Europe. vatsim germany knowledgebase

In real life, you talk to the tower. On VATSIM Germany, if no Approach controller is online, the Center controller (Radar) handles your descent. The Knowledgebase details exactly how "Top-Down" service works in Germany, including which frequencies to use and what services you forfeit.
